Preferred Experience: Under general supervision, the Public Safety Response Coordinator position performs a variety of complex functions, which includes, but not limited to entering and accessing real-time information into the computer-aided dispatch (CAD) System,), operate & monitor closed-circuit television (CCTV) System at all BRCC Locations, acts as the point of contact with the general public for emergency situations, accidents, complaints, etc., receive and respond to requests from enforcement officers/agents. The incumbent is also required by the National Crime Information Center (NCIC) and the Louisiana State Police to obtain credentials in accessing and adhering to Terminal Operator Certification Program Guidelines to meet the terminal operator certification and re-certification requirement within six months of employment.

40% Response Coordination  
30% Operate & Monitor CCTV (Closed-circuit television).
  10% Maintenance
10% Customer-Service Representative
5% NCIC & Compliance.
5% Other duties as assigned
